Position summary:Our GI Techs has the unique opportunity to contribute to a harmonious work environment by providing a balance of hands-on patient care while supporting our Team at GI Associates. The GI Technician is responsible for assisting in the collection of data for an objective assessment by the RN to identify the patient’s needs, problems, concerns or human responses. This position maintains responsibility for the scopes, and disinfecting instrumentation, pathology log, and collating post procedure information. Position Responsibilities:
  • Responsible for setting up equipment pre-procedure
  • Helps with post procedure process for patients under the supervision of RN
  • Knowledgeable of proper handling of equipment and materials (scopes, light sources, and ancillary equipment)
  • Transports used equipment post-procedure to the reprocessing room
  • Cleans equipment in conjunction with the OSHA guidelines
  • Helps maintain appropriate records/logs for the high-level disinfecting process of endoscopic equipment
  • Maintains adequate supply of chemicals and equipment for equipment reprocessing
  • Assists with room turn around/setup/cleaning of procedure rooms to optimize room efficiency
  • Assists in maintaining room stock/supplies
  • Transports patients as directed
  • Promotes an environment that is patient and employee friendly
  • Maintains high level of confidentiality pertaining to the patients right to privacy
  • Working collaboratively with GIA members to optimize patient care and be influential in maintaining a healthy team environment
  • Eager and willingness to learn and grow in the knowledge of GI Anatomy and Physiology, Disease
  • Complete all medical documentation efficiently in a timely manner
  • Recognize and respond to emergency care needs as per policy
  • Maintains safe work environment
Minimum requirements
  • High School diploma or equivalent
  • Practice-based learning and improvement, empathy, and clinical judgement
  • Basic Life Support (BLS) certification from the American Heart Association or ability to obtain upon hire

Desired Qualifications
  • Healthcare experience (1 Year)
